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ost In Brentwood, TN

The cost of Drywall Water Damage Repair in Brentwood, TN,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drywall Repair and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, number of drywall panels damaged
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, number of touch-ups required

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ary depending on the specific needs of your property.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a customized repair plan that meets your budget and needs.

How do I prevent water damage in the future?

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es and appliances regularly for signs of wear or damage, and address any issues quickly. You should also consider installing a water sensor or leak detector to alert you to potential problems.
